Rishi Sunak spent £500,000 in lower than ten days on non-public jet flights

3 min read

Government information confirmed UK Prime Minister Rishi Sunak took non-public jet journeys costing virtually £500,000, in simply over every week.

By India Today World Desk: In simply over every week, UK Prime Minister Rishi Sunak took non-public jet journeys costing virtually ã500,000, stated a report by The Guardian, citing authorities information on bills by the PM on abroad journey. The Opposition has slammed Sunak over the expenditure, saying it clashes together with his pledges to curb local weather change.

This comes after Sunak got here underneath fireplace in January for taking a 30-minute non-public jet flight from London to go to a healthcare facility in Leeds.

The information produced by the Cabinet Office confirmed Rishi Sunak’s one-day go to to Egypt in November 2022 for the COP27 summit value ã107,966 for personal jet journey. Every week later, on November 13, he went to the G20 summit in Bali, Indonesia and got here again on November 17, a spherical journey that value greater than ã340,000.

Shortly after, the UK prime minister took a day-long journey to Latvia and Estonia to go to troops, a visit that value greater than ã62,000.

The information on abroad prime ministerial journey within the third quarter of 2022 additionally confirmed the price of Liz Truss’s journey to Prague in October 2022, which amounted to virtually ã40,000.

The Liberal Democrats hit out at Sunak over the bills and stated, “This is a stunning waste of taxpayers’ cash at a time when persons are struggling to pay their payments. Yet once more this Conservative authorities is totally out of contact.

This is a stunning waste of taxpayer’s cash at a time when most individuals are struggling to pay their payments or put meals on the desk.

Wera Hobhouse, the celebration’s vitality and local weather spokesperson hit out on the authorities and stated, “They can pretend to care about a greener future with their so-called ‘Green Day’, but in reality they do not care.”

The information additionally confirmed that just about one other ã20,000 was spent on different prices for the prime ministers, together with lodging, meals and visas. The prices don’t embrace the prices for different officers who additionally went on the journeys.

A spokesperson for 10 Downing Street defended Sunak’s flights. “The role of the prime minister includes holding vital meetings with world leaders during bilateral visits and summits to discuss issues of international importance – including security, defence and trade,” the spokesperson was quoted by The Guardian as saying.

All the flights listed within the doc concerned an Airbus A-321 operated by the constitution provider Titan Airways on behalf of the UK authorities.
